Kingdavid

KING-day-vid

Kingdavid is a boy’s name of Hebrew origin, meaning “Combines 'King' with 'David', a Hebrew name meaning 'beloved'.”. It currently ranks #7040 in the US, and peaked in popularity in 2018.

The Story of Kingdavid

This name was sung by poets and carried by warriors, a blend of love and leadership.

Kingdavid is a profound combination, linking the English 'King' with the ancient Hebrew name 'David'. 'David' means 'beloved,' a name deeply entwined with biblical kingship and psalms. Its recorded use began around 2006, giving new life to an enduring legacy.
